What is Bitcoin Cash (BCH)?

Bitcoin Cash (BCH) is a decentralized digital currency created to address performance bottlenecks in the Bitcoin network. While it shares Bitcoin’s core principles—such as decentralization, limited supply (21 million coins), and proof-of-work consensus—it diverges significantly in design philosophy. The primary innovation? A much larger block size, allowing more transactions to be processed per block.

The goal of Bitcoin Cash is simple: return to Satoshi Nakamoto’s original vision of a peer-to-peer electronic cash system. Its developers argue that Bitcoin has shifted toward being a “digital gold” store of value, while BCH remains focused on utility as a fast, low-cost payment method.

The History and Origin of Bitcoin Cash

As Bitcoin gained popularity in the early 2010s, its 1 MB block size limit began causing network congestion. During peak usage, transactions took hours—or even days—to confirm, with fees skyrocketing into double-digit USD amounts. This sparked intense debate within the crypto community about how to scale the network.

One faction advocated for off-chain scaling solutions like the Lightning Network. Another group pushed for increasing the block size directly—a more straightforward but controversial approach. Unable to reach consensus, the network underwent a hard fork on August 1, 2017, resulting in the creation of Bitcoin Cash.

Holders of Bitcoin at the time of the fork received an equal amount of BCH, and mining power gradually shifted to support the new chain. Since then, Bitcoin Cash has evolved independently, introducing upgrades aimed at improving functionality and adoption.


How Does Bitcoin Cash Work?

At its core, Bitcoin Cash operates similarly to Bitcoin but with critical technical differences that enhance performance.

Block Size and Scalability

The defining feature of BCH is its larger block size, currently capped at 32 MB. This allows thousands of transactions per block, reducing congestion and enabling rapid processing even during high-demand periods. In contrast, Bitcoin’s smaller blocks often lead to delays and higher fees when usage spikes.

Transaction Speed and Confirmation Time

Thanks to larger blocks, Bitcoin Cash typically confirms transactions in under 10 minutes, sometimes faster depending on network load. This makes it far more practical for real-time payments than Bitcoin during busy times.

Lower Transaction Fees

With greater capacity comes lower competition for space. As a result, average transaction fees on the BCH network are often less than $0.01, making it ideal for microtransactions or frequent small-value transfers.

Disadvantages and Risks

Despite its strengths, Bitcoin Cash faces several challenges:

Limited Adoption Compared to Bitcoin

While accepted by merchants like Overstock and Newegg, and supported by payment processors such as BitPay and Purse, BCH lags behind BTC in global recognition and exchange listings.

Centralization Concerns

Larger blocks require more bandwidth and storage, potentially favoring large mining pools over individual miners. Critics argue this could undermine decentralization—the foundational principle of blockchain networks.

Intense Market Competition

BCH competes not only with Bitcoin but also with other fast, low-fee cryptocurrencies like Litecoin, Bitcoin SV, and various layer-2 solutions built on Ethereum.

Is Bitcoin Cash Accepted for Payments?

Yes—though not universally. Major online retailers including Overstock, Newegg, and select Shopify stores accept BCH via gateways like BitPay. Its low fees make it attractive for merchants seeking efficient settlement without volatility risk if converted immediately to fiat.

For users, spending BCH is as easy as scanning a QR code or confirming a wallet transaction—just like using any digital payment app.

Frequently Asked Questions (FAQ)

Q: Is Bitcoin Cash the same as Bitcoin?
A: No. While both are decentralized cryptocurrencies using proof-of-work, Bitcoin Cash has larger blocks (up to 32 MB), faster transactions, and lower fees than Bitcoin.

Q: Can I mine Bitcoin Cash?
A: Yes. BCH uses SHA-256 mining similar to BTC, but requires specific software and hardware optimized for the BCH network.

Q: Is Bitcoin Cash a good investment?
A: It depends on your goals. BCH offers utility as digital cash but carries risks due to lower adoption and market volatility.

Q: How do I store Bitcoin Cash safely?
A: Use a hardware wallet like Ledger or Trezor for maximum security, or trusted software wallets like Electron Cash for convenience.

Q: Does Bitcoin Cash support smart contracts?
A: Not natively like Ethereum, but recent upgrades like CashTokens enable tokenization and basic programmable functions.

Q: Will Bitcoin Cash replace Bitcoin?
A: Unlikely. BTC dominates as a store of value; BCH aims instead to complement it by focusing on fast, low-cost payments.
